HMB Benefits

Muscle protein synthesis
Reduced muscle breakdown
Enhanced strength gains
Improved recovery
Lean mass preservation

Artichoke Extract Benefits

Supports liver function and detoxification
Promotes healthy cholesterol levels
Enhances digestive enzyme production
Reduces bloating and indigestion
Provides antioxidant protection
